The rapid progress of development of the Smartphone as well as positioningtechniques has promoted various kinds of Location Based Services, such as the wellknown app Baidu Map and the Dazhong Dianping application. The common point forthose services is that they all need to gather users’ location information first. However,if users’ locations are gathered by some malicious adversaries, they can be faced withthreats of location privacy disclosure. Therefore, more and more people are interestedin this and much research efforts have been spent on this research area.For the most of the privacy protection techniques can be classified into threecategories, named as Fake ID Technique, Fake Location Technique and theAnonymous Space Technique. The Anonymous Space Technique has received lots ofresearch effort since it can both combine good privacy protection ability as well asvery little service influence. The existing solutions for Anonymous Space Techniquebasically form into two architectures. They are the P2P based architecture and theTrusted Third Party architecture. This paper focus on the P2P architecture and try tosolve an existing trust related flaw and also try to propose a new solution calledK-Zone which does not require every mobile user to share its location with each otherbut use a well generated anonymous space instead. This paper also proposes threealgorithms for our K-Zone solution, which are EA Algorithm, WA Algorithm andOEA Algorithm. Through a set of comprehensive experiments, we carefully compareour three algorithms in terms of user density, region area and running time.The main effort of our paper includes:(1) Analysis of current attack models for location privacy in mobile internet.(2) Analysis of current privacy protection techniques’ advantages as well asdisadvantages.(3) Propose the K-Zone solution for the existing trust related flaw which enablesmobile users to share well generated space instead.(4) Simulate the three algorithms in a real world map with well generated moving object data in terms of user density, region area and running time.
